The assault on Delhi Chief Minister Rekha Gupta has ignited a wave of concern and prompted a thorough investigation into the motives and potential connections of the accused, Rajesh Sakriya Khimjibhai. The incident, which occurred during a 'Jan Sunwai' programme at her Civil Lines camp office, has resulted in Khimjibhai being remanded to five days of police custody. This allows authorities to delve deeper into his background, potential accomplices, and the precise sequence of events leading up to the attack. The charges levied against him, under Sections 109(1), 132, and 221 of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S), highlight the severity of the alleged crime, classified as an attempt-to-murder. The involvement of both the Intelligence Bureau (IB) and Delhi Police's Special Cell underscores the gravity of the situation and the need to explore all possible angles, including the possibility of a larger conspiracy. The statements from PWD minister Parvesh Verma, describing the CM's injuries and characterizing the attack as premeditated and potentially life-threatening, further emphasize the gravity of the situation. The minister’s assertion suggests that the attack was not a spontaneous act but a carefully planned operation aimed at causing significant harm. The fact that Khimjibhai allegedly gained entry to the camp office under the guise of a complainant adds another layer of complexity to the narrative, suggesting a deliberate attempt to deceive security personnel and gain proximity to the CM. The alleged act of slapping the CM and grabbing her hair before being overpowered further indicates the violent nature of the assault and the intent to inflict physical harm and create chaos. Delhi minister Kapil Mishra's description of the incident as "not an ordinary attack" reinforces the suspicion that the assault was motivated by more than just personal grievances. His claim that the accused attempted to push the CM to the ground further paints a picture of a deliberate and potentially fatal assault. The police investigation is focusing on uncovering any potential political or ideological motivations behind the attack, as well as identifying any individuals or groups who may have influenced or supported Khimjibhai's actions. The revelation that Khimjibhai traveled from Rajkot, Gujarat, to Delhi just two days prior to the attack suggests a planned operation, further fueling suspicions of premeditation and potential external influence. His stay in the Civil Lines area of North Delhi provides investigators with a specific location to focus their search for evidence and potential witnesses. While Khimjibhai claims his actions were motivated by the Supreme Court's recent order on stray dogs, investigators are treating this claim with skepticism, recognizing the possibility that it may be a smokescreen to conceal a more sinister agenda. The recovery of two videos of the 'Jan Sunwai' programme from his mobile phone, along with CCTV footage showing him conducting a recce of the CM's private residence in Shalimar Bagh, provides compelling evidence of pre-planning and deliberate preparation for the attack. The CCTV footage, in particular, suggests a methodical approach to the assault, with Khimjibhai seemingly scouting the location and making preparations well in advance. Rajesh Sakriya Khimjibhai's past brushes with the law paint a picture of a man with a history of violence and disregard for legal boundaries. The five FIRs registered against him at Bhaktinagar police station between 2017 and 2024, including two related to assault and criminal intimidation, demonstrate a pattern of aggressive behavior and a willingness to use force. The three cases under the Excise Act for liquor possession and transportation suggest a disregard for regulations and a propensity for engaging in illegal activities. While he was arrested in all five cases, his acquittal in four suggests potential loopholes in the legal process or difficulties in securing convictions. The pending liquor case indicates that his legal troubles are ongoing. Deputy commissioner of police Jagdish Bangarva's statement provides official confirmation of Khimjibhai's criminal record and his repeated encounters with law enforcement. Inspector M M Sarvaiya's confirmation that Sakriya had been taken into custody several times but managed to walk free in most cases raises questions about the effectiveness of the legal system in deterring his criminal behavior. However, conflicting with his criminal record, neighbors describe Khimjibhai as a man obsessed with stray dogs, dedicating significant time and resources to their care. Their accounts depict a man who often ferried injured strays to hospitals in his rickshaw, providing them with daily sustenance and even discussing the possibility of building a shelter home for them. This seemingly contradictory behavior raises questions about Khimjibhai's psychological state and the potential motivations behind his actions. The neighbors' observations suggest a compassionate side to Khimjibhai, a stark contrast to his violent tendencies. The fact that he allegedly approached an industrialist for donations to build a shelter home further reinforces his commitment to the welfare of stray dogs. His mother's claim that he was a "dog lover" who was disturbed by the Supreme Court's recent order on strays in Delhi provides a possible explanation for his actions, albeit one that is unlikely to absolve him of responsibility for the attack. She maintains that he had no political affiliations, a claim that is being investigated by authorities.
